Web• An approaching tsunamis is sometimes preceded by a noticeable rise or fall of coastal water. This is a natural warning; people should move inland away from the shoreline. • When the sea begins to drain away, do not go to investigate, but quickly go inland away from the shoreline. • Never go down to the beach to watch for a tsunami. http://itic.ioc-unesco.org/index.php?option=com_content&view=article&id=1133&Itemid=2155
